Let it shift on its own. When I had the open diff in my truck I would leave the line from idle, pedal to the floor, let it build some boost and just before the "tire" would spin I would let up all the way on the go pedal and then put it right back down to the floor. That was when my truck was making less power also.

Id say build 2-3 lbs of boost, and just experiment at the drag strip. You may burn the tires some, but a little bark wont hurt anything as long as it doesent roast them. When i went to the drag strip and was launching with about 3psi in 2wd it would burn them a little, and then hook and go. At first i tried 10psi in 2wd That was fun. Burnt the crap outta the tires. I launch in 4wd now at 10psi, but dont want to go any further for fear of breaking the input shaft. Thats what it takes is experimenting, and examination of 60ft times to get it to do the best. You may be into 16.5's. I just really couldnt tell you, as i havent really ridden in any modded 1st gen's. Only thing you can do is run it and see. Im with the rest. Let it shift on its own. You need to be as close to the peak torque as you can get, so let er shift. Might try launching at 6-8psi and then instead of matting it, just roll into the throttle slow enough to keep it from spinning. never tried it, but that is what you have to do, is experiment. Good luck Let us know how it does if u go.

I got one run waiting 3 hours. Well I ran 16.25@79.25, .300 reaction, 2.6/60', 10.40 1/8th. Idled off the line. I would have ran over 80 but I lifted thinking that I had passed the line. The camaro beside me confused me because he quit early. I have a video but its 37 megs because I didn't shut it off after the run was over. I think I could pull 15.7s with the all the extra weight out of the truck, and a set of 285s out back. 3lbs of boost and I get wheel spin.

Those are some good numbers. Get yourself a posi, I gained 7 tenths by getting rid of the open diff, and thats with 235's. Although I can still easily spin the tires through first and part of second, so its time for a set of DOT slicks. Then I gotta finish hookin up my water/meth and get a taller gov spring, should put me in the solid 13's.
